NASHIK: In a first, chief minister Devendra Fadnavis on Saturday launched a pilot project that seeks to provide 12-hour power supply to 600 farmers in Ralegan Siddhi through 2MW Solar Agriculture Feeder Project.
The project is built in a PPP (Public Private Partnership) between State Power Generation Company Limited (MSPGCL) and Maharashtra Energy Development Agency (MEDA) at the cost of Rs 6 crore.Launching the project, Fadnavis, said, "The government has decided to power agriculture only through solar projects.We have set a target of raising 435 MW through solar power projects in the villages with the aim of cutting down transmission costs."
